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add basic 4.2 compatibility #965

Open
2 of 6 tasks
zenmonkeykstop opened this issue Mar 26, 2024 · 0 comments
Open
2 of 6 tasks

Add basic 4.2 compatibility #965

zenmonkeykstop opened this issue Mar 26, 2024 · 0 comments
Assignees

Comments

@zenmonkeykstop
Copy link
Contributor

zenmonkeykstop commented Mar 26, 2024

Support for Qubes 4.2 was investigated in #898, which updated policies and split out the launcher script to a separate repo, among other changes. A new branch has been created cherry-picking desired changes from this PR, and reinstating the launcher as part of the securedrop workstation repo.

table of cherry-picks and rationales
original commit status in new branch notes  
052e5a6 NOT INCLUDED superseded by 4d841fa  
4d841fa NOT INCLUDED already in main  
98b5bb3 INCLUDED mostly does the bump to f37  
4534157 NOT INCLUDED launcher no longer being split out  
c2ce8d4 NOT INCLUDED already in main  
a708a60 NOT INCLUDED merge commit, already in main  
99b72a5 INCLUDED RPC migration - needs further review tho, to make sure legacy policies aren't overriding the rules here  
b127b66 NOT INCLUDED launcher no longer being split out  
416543a NOT INCLUDED main already on fedora-38 (we actually need to bump it to fedora-39)  
e873481 INCLUDED handles -xfce suffix, could probably be improved.  
5d9dd4d NOT INCLUDED main already uses whonix-*-17  
9979601 NOT INCLUDED changed in error  
d1aadfc NOT INCLUDED revert for above error  
4d6ca1a INCLUDED -xfce' strikes again  
9f9d1d3 INCLUDED adds workaround as described  
 

Further work will proceed using this branch as a base, subtasks as follows:

Once this level of basic compatibility has been achieved and a running 4.2 workstation can be installed, this branch can be merged to main, switching it to being 4.2-only and allowing for further changes as per the roadmap.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
Archived in project
Development

No branches or pull requests

1 participant